In this episode of The Story Behind the Camera: Capturing the History of ABA, we explore the innovative storytelling techniques of filmmaker and behavioral scientist Ryan O'Donnell. Ryan, creator of the documentary The History of Applied Behavior Analysis: Part I, shares the creative and ethical process behind his work, including a captivating moment where he brought one of ABA’s historical figures to life. With permission from a surviving relative, Ryan used AI voice technology to recreate the figure’s voice, allowing them to read a personal letter from the past. In addition, Ryan reflects on his early days on YouTube, where he first began merging his passions for filmmaking and behavior analysis. This episode highlights how Ryan’s groundbreaking work is preserving the legacy of ABA through technology and storytelling in a truly unique way.
